body{PADDING-RIGHT:0px;PADDING-LEFT:0px;FONT-SIZE:12px;PADDING-BOTTOM:0px;MARGIN:0px;PADDING-TOP:0px;FONT-FAMILY: "微软雅黑", "宋体","黑体",Verdana, Arial, Helvetica, sans-serif;
line-height:20px; background:#eff2f4; background-image: url("../images/bg.png");}
table{ margin:0 auto;border-spacing:0;border-collapse:collapse; }
img{border:0;}
ol,ul,li{padding:0px;margin:0px;list-style-type:none;}
caption,th {text-align:left;}
form,ul,li,h1,h2,h3,h4,h5,h6,p,dl,dd,dt.input{margin:0px;padding:0px;}
address,caption,cite,code,dfn,em,th,var {font-weight:normal; font-style:normal;} 
A:link,A:visited{TEXT-DECORATION:none; }
A:hover { TEXT-DECORATION:none; color:#900;}
a{color:#333333;}
.clear {clear:both; height:0; line-height:0; overflow:hidden;}

ul.nl {list-style:none outside none; margin:0; padding:0}
ul.nl li {line-height:30px;padding-left:15px;background: url(../images/yy-1_03.png) left center no-repeat; font-size:15px;}


.tzzlisaaa{ width:98%; margin:0 auto;   height:auto; margin-top:15px; margin-bottom:10px;}

.dateR {float:right;padding-right:5px}
.gray {text-decoration:none;font-size:14px}
.dsds{ width:197px; height:40px;background:url(../images/gg-1_06.png) no-repeat; text-indent:35px; font-size:15px; line-height:40px;margin-bottom:10px;}
.dsdsa{ width:197px; height:40px;background:url(../images/gg-1_03.png) no-repeat; text-indent:35px; font-size:15px; line-height:40px;margin-bottom:10px;}
.dsdsa a{ color:#fff;}
.dsds a{ color:#fff;}
#scrollup1jsu10js table{width:100%;}
#scrollup1jsu10js table a span{text-align:left;float:left;}
#scrollup1jsu10js table span{text-align:right;float:right; }

#scrollup2jsu10js table{width:100%;}
#scrollup2jsu10js table a span{text-align:left;float:left;}
#scrollup2jsu10js table span{text-align:right;float:right; }
.time{color:#F00}
.top{ height:43px; background:#76b4c4; min-width:1200px ; width:100%;}
.topc{ /* background: url(../images/topb.png) repeat-x; */ height:43px; width:1200px; margin:0 auto;}
.topclf{ width:620px; float:left; padding-left:10px;}
.topclf li{ line-height:43px; background:url(../images/gx_10.png) left center no-repeat; text-indent:5px; font-size:14px; float:left; padding-right:10px;}
.topcrr{ width:420px; float:right; height:43px;}
.topcrr_lf{ width:232px; float:left; background: url(../images/gx_02.png) right no-repeat;height:43px;}
.topcrr_lfh{ width:162px; float:left; height:23px; margin-top:10px;}
#demo{height:360px; overflow:hidden;}
.topcrr_lfh input{ width:162px; float:left; height:22px; border:0px;}
.topbo{ width:48px; height:24px; float:left; margin-left:10px;margin-top:10px;}
.topcrr_rr{ width:170px; float:left; height:43px;}
.topcrr_rr li{ float:left; line-height:43px; font-size:14px; padding-left:10px;}
.logo{ height:133px; background: url(../images/gx_27.png) 750px 0 no-repeat; margin:0 auto; width:1200px;}
.logo_lf{ width:339px; height:85px; float:left; margin:20px 0px 0px 0px;}
.logo_rr{ width:432px; float:right; height:86px; margin-top:20px;}
.logo_rr li{ width:85px; float:left; text-align:center;}
.wd1200{ background:#fff; height:auto; width:1200px; margin:0 auto;}
.nav{ width:1169px; margin:0 auto; height:57px;padding-left:5px;}

.tltkts{ width:95%; border-left:2px solid #3571c3; margin:0 auto;   height:auto; margin-top:15px; min-height:80px; margin-bottom:20px; border-bottom:1px dashed #ccc;margin-top:25px; }
.tltktslf{ width:150px; float:left; font-size:18px; text-indent:20px;}
.tltktslfvv{ width:730px; float:left; font-size:18px;}
.tltktslfvv li{background:url(../images/gx_10.png) left center no-repeat; text-indent:5px; height:35xp; font-size:14px; width:28%; float:left; margin-right:3%; line-height:35px;}



.navmain {MARGIN: 0px auto; width:1000px;height:49px; line-height:49px;}

.nav LI:hover UL {Z-INDEX:900;}
.nav LI {FONT-SIZE: 15px;FLOAT: left; line-height:57px;HEIGHT:57px; font-family:"微软雅黑"; }
.nav LI A {DISPLAY: inline-block; text-align:center; COLOR: #fff; text-decoration: none; FONT-SIZE:20px}
/*.nav LI UL {DISPLAY: none;Z-INDEX: 99;LEFT: 50%;MARGIN-LEFT: -500px;POSITION: absolute;TOP:232px;}*/
/*.nav LI UL LI {PADDING-RIGHT: 10px; PADDING-LEFT: 0px;   HEIGHT: auto;}*/
/*.nav LI UL LI P {FONT-SIZE: 12px;}*/
/*.nav LI UL LI A {COLOR: #000;}*/
.nav LI.h_bg {DISPLAY: block;  COLOR: #ffffff; background:url(../images/gx_40.png) repeat-x; }



.nav LI.h_bg .row A {COLOR: #333}
.nav f14{font-size:14px;font-weight:bold;}
.chanpzh{ width:1150px; border:3px solid #76B4C4; min-height:50px; background:#f7fbfe; padding:10px; margin-left:-87px;}
.chanpzhlf{ width:1160px; float:left; height:auto;}
.chanpzhlfl{ width:290px; min-height:29px; line-height:29px; background:url(../images/hhh11_04.png) left center no-repeat; text-align:left !important; font-size:14px; float:left; margin-top:3px;font-size:14px;}
.chanpzhlfl a{ display:block;}
.chanpzhlfl a:hover{  background:url(../images/lk_03.jpg) no-repeat; color: #0b97c4;}
.chanpzhlfl a{ width:290px;min-height:29px; line-height:29px;background:url(../images/hhh11_04.png) left center no-repeat; font-size:14px;float:left;  margin-top:3px;font-size:14px;}
.tzzliswbb{ width:95%; margin:0 auto;   height:auto; margin-top:15px; }

#vsb_content_2 p{font-size:14px; line-height:30px !important;}


.bannercvv{ width:1174px; height:250px; margin:0 auto;padding-top:10px; }

.banner{ width:1174px; height:362px; margin:0 auto; padding:15px 0px;}

/*bnner切换*/
.ck-slide { width: 1174px; height: 362px; margin: 0 auto; position: relative; overflow: hidden;}
.ck-slide ul.ck-slide-wrapper { height: 334px; position: absolute; top: 0; left: 0; z-index: 1; margin: 0; padding: 0;}
.ck-slide ul.ck-slide-wrapper li a { /*a标签是行内元素，宽高对a标签不起作用，这里必须添加line-height:0px;display:black，否则垂直滚动<li>之间会出现间隔*/line-height:0px; display:block;}

.ck-slide .ck-prev, .ck-slide .ck-next { position: absolute; top: 50%; z-index: 2; width: 35px; height: 70px; margin-top: -35px; border-radius: 3px; opacity: .15; background: red; text-indent: -9999px; background-repeat: no-repeat; transition: opacity .2s linear 0s;}
.ck-slide .ck-prev { left: 5px;	background: url(../images/arrow-left.png) #000 50% no-repeat;}
.ck-slide .ck-next { right: 5px; background: url(../images/arrow-right.png) #000 50% no-repeat;}

.ck-slidebox { position: absolute; left: 50%; bottom: 12px; z-index: 30;}
.ck-slidebox ul { height: 20px; padding: 0 4px; border-radius: 8px; background: rgba(0,0,0,0.5);}
.ck-slidebox ul li { float: left; height: 12px; margin: 4px 4px;}
.ck-slidebox ul li em { display: block;	width: 12px; height: 12px; border-radius: 100%;	background-color: #fff;	text-indent: -9999px; cursor: pointer;}
.ck-slidebox ul li.current em { background-color: #b53c31;}
.ck-slidebox ul li em:hover { background-color: #b53c31;}

.mdyw{ width:1174px; height:430px; margin:0 auto;}
/*.mdyw_lf{ border:1px solid #c5c5c5; height:428px; width:850px; float:left;} 2024-04-11修改*/
.mdyw_lf{ border:1px solid #c5c5c5; height:428px;}
.mdyw_top{ height:42px; border-bottom:3px solid #3571c3; width:98%; margin:0 auto;}
.mdyw_toplf{ background: url(../images/www_10.png) no-repeat; width:156px; height:32px; margin-top:10px;  text-align:center; line-height:32px; font-size:16px; color:#fff; float:left;}
.mdyyplf{ background:#3571c3; width:100px; height:32px; margin-top:10px;  text-align:center; line-height:32px; font-size:16px; color:#fff; float:left; margin-left:10px;}

.kstd{ background:#3571c3; width:100px; height:32px; margin-top:0px;  text-align:center; line-height:32px; font-size:16px; color:#fff; float:left; margin-left:10px; }
/*.mdrrop{ height:42px; border-bottom:1px solid #124b98; width:100%; margin:0 auto;}*/
.mdrrop{  width:100%; height:51px; margin-bottom:7px; border-bottom:1px solid #3571c3;}


.mdyw_toprr{ font-size:14px; width:50px; float:right; line-height:44px; }
.ywtt{ height:100px; border-bottom:1px dashed #bbbbbb; width:98%; margin:0 auto; padding:10px 0px;}
.ywtt h3{ font-size:24px; color:#b80000; text-align:center; line-height:45px;}
.ywtt h3 a{color:#b80000;}

.ywtt p{ color:#818181; font-size:14px; line-height:24px;}
.ywtt p a{color:#818181;}
.ywtt_bot{ height:234px; width:98%; margin:0 auto; padding:13px 0px;}
.ywtt_botlf{ width:402px; float:left; height:234px;}
.ywtt_botrr{ width:408px; float:right; height:auto; }
.ywtt_botrr li{  text-align:right; line-height:30px;font-size:14px;color:#6e6e6e;}
.ywtt_botrr li a{ text-align:left; float:left;font-size:15px;}
/*.tzz{ border:1px solid #c5c5c5; height:428px; width:307px; float:right;} 2024-04-11 修改*/
.tzz{ border:1px solid #c5c5c5; height:348px;}

.tzzlis{ width:95%; margin:0 auto;   height:auto; margin-top:15px; }
.tzzlis li{  text-align:right; line-height:31px;font-size:12px; background:url(../images/gx_66.png) left center no-repeat; text-indent:5px;color:#6e6e6e;}
.tzzlis li a{ text-align:left; float:left;font-size:14px;}
.xuw{ width:1174px; height:auto; margin:0 auto; padding:15px 0px 0px 0px;}
.xuwlf{ width:900px; float:left; height:auto;}
.xuwimg{padding:1px; border:1px solid #c5c5c5;}
.xuwqh{ width:100%; height:320px; margin-top:15px;}
.xuwqhlf{ width:472px; height:318px;border:1px solid #c5c5c5; float:left;}
.xuwqhrr{ width:472px; height:318px;border:1px solid #c5c5c5; float: right;}

.cont{padding:0px;}
.hidden{display:none;}
.scrolldoorFrame{width:100%;overflow:hidden;}
.scrollUl{width:98%;overflow:hidden;height:34px; margin:0 auto; margin-top:10px; border-bottom:3px solid #3571c3;}
.scrollUl li{float:left;}
.sd01{cursor:pointer; min-width:100px;  padding:0 10px;background: url(../images/www_033.png) left no-repeat #3571c3;height:34px; line-height:34px; text-indent:25px; font-size:16px; color:#ffffff;   }
.sd01 a{color:#ffffff;}
.sd02{cursor:pointer;min-width:100px; padding:0 10px; background: url(../images/www_05.jpg) left   no-repeat #76b4c4; height:34px; line-height:34px;text-indent:25px; font-size:16px; color:#ffffff; }
.sd02 a{color:#ffffff;}
.xslist{ width:95%; margin:0 auto;   height:auto; margin-top:15px; }
.xslist li{  text-align:right; line-height:31px;font-size:12px; color:#6e6e6e; }
.xslist li a{ text-align:left; float:left;font-size:14px;}

.gens{ width:40px; height:44px; line-height:44px; font-size:14px; position:absolute; top:-60px; right:0px;}

.zit{ height:188px; border:1px solid #c5c5c5; margin-top:15px;}
.zitim{ height:117px; width:1150px; margin:0 auto; margin-top:15px;}
.ks196{ float:right; height:auto;width:260px;}
.kstz{ width:100%; height:41px; margin-bottom:7px; border-bottom:1px solid #3571c3;}
.kslis{ width:100%; height:auto;}
.kslis li{ height:36px; margin-top:12px; font-size:15px; line-height:36px; text-indent:54px;}
.li01{ background:url(../images/gx_001.png) no-repeat;}
.li01:hover{ background:url(../images/gx_93.png) no-repeat;}
.li02{ background:url(../images/gx_95.png) no-repeat;}
.li02:hover{ background:url(../images/gx_002.png) no-repeat;}
.li03{ background:url(../images/gx_101.png) no-repeat;}
.li03:hover{ background:url(../images/gx_003.png) no-repeat;}
.li04{ background:url(../images/gx_114.png) no-repeat;}
.li04:hover{ background:url(../images/gx_004.png) no-repeat;}
.li05{ background:url(../images/gx_116.png) no-repeat;}
.li05:hover{ background:url(../images/gx_005.png) no-repeat;}
.li06{ background:url(../images/gx_118.png) no-repeat;}
.li06:hover{ background:url(../images/gx_006.png) no-repeat;}
.li07{ background:url(../images/gx_120.png) no-repeat;}
.li07:hover{ background:url(../images/gx_007.png) no-repeat;}
.li08{ background:url(../images/gx_124.png) no-repeat;}
.li08:hover{ background:url(../images/gx_008.png) no-repeat;}
.li09{ background:url(../images/gx_129.png) no-repeat;}
.li09:hover{ background:url(../images/gx_009.png) no-repeat;}
.li010{ background:url(../images/gx_116.png) no-repeat;}
.li010:hover{ background:url(../images/gx_005.png) no-repeat;}

.quick_li {
    height:36px; margin-top:12px; font-size:14px; line-height:36px; text-indent:54px;
}

.youq{ width:260px;border:1px solid #c5c5c5; height:115px; margin-top:0px;}
.link35{ width:170px; height:30px; margin:0 auto; margin-top:25px;}

.bott{ height:150px; width:1174px; margin:0 auto; background:#f9f9f9; padding-top:15px; border-top:3px solid #3571c3;}
.bottlf{ width:1119px; float:left; height:107px; margin-left:34px;}
.bottlf_top{ height:35px; line-height:35px;}
.bottlf_top li{ float:left; padding:0px 5px; font-size:14px;}
.bottbq{ width:100%; height:auto; }
.bottbq p{ line-height:30px; font-size:14px;}
.rrcc{ width:320px; float:right; height:62px; margin-top:40px;}
.rrcc li{ float:left; width:75px; text-align:center; height:62px; border-right:1px  dotted #000;}

.klis6{ float: left; height:auto;width:196px;}
.klis6rr{ width:960px; float:right; height:auto;border:1px solid #c5c5c5;}
.fany{ height:40px; text-align:center;}

.kccrr{ width:1172px; float:right; height:auto;border:1px solid #c5c5c5;}

.kkcot{ width:95%; height:auto; margin:0 auto;}
.ddh3{ font-size:26px; font-weight:normal; padding:20px 0px; text-align:center; line-height:40px;}
.ddp{ text-align:center; line-height:35px; border-bottom:1px dashed #ccc;}
.kkcotddc{ font-size:16px; height:auto; padding:20px 0px; text-align:left;}
.kkcotddc p{ padding-bottom:15px; line-height:30px; text-indent:28px;}
.faj7{ height:70px; border-top:1px dashed #ccc; padding-top:20px;}
.faj7 p{ line-height:30px;}
.mdkkprr{ font-size:14px; min-width:50px; float:right; line-height:44px; padding-right:20px; }

.ewm-list{
  width:321px;float:right;
  height:78px;
  background: url(../images/ff_03.png) no-repeat right bottom ;
  margin-right:15px;margin-top:30px;
  
}
.ewm-list div{
  width:70px;
  height:70px;
  float: right;
  position: relative;
}

.ewm-list div .ewm-img{
  width:auto;
  height:auto;
  position: absolute;
  bottom:69px;
  left:-17px;
  display: none;
}
.ewm-list div .ewm-img img{
  width:100px;
  height:100px;
}
.ewm-list div a{
  display: block;
  width:70px;
  height:70px;
}
.KSS_titleBoxh h2{
  height:50px;
}

/*pageClass: 翻页DIV class
pageStyle: 翻页DIV style
currPageClass:当前页码class
norPageClass:其他页码class*/


/*
prev-page 左翻页
next-page 右翻页
Num 未选中的页码
on 选中的页码
Num-input 跳转框 Num-btn 跳转按钮
*/

.page-large {
    margin: 5px auto;
    text-align: right;
 }
.prev-page,.next-page {
    width: 30px;
    text-align: center;
    display: inline-block;
    /*background-color: #3571c3;*/
    margin-left: 10px;
    border-radius: 5px;
}
.prev-page:hover,.next-page:hover {
    background-color: #ef9701;
}

.Num {
    width: 35px;
    line-height: 35px;
    text-align: center;
    display: inline-block;
    margin-left: 5px;
    border-radius: 5px;
}

.Num:hover {
    background-color: #ef9701;
    color: #ffffff;
}

.on {
    background-color: #ef9701;
    color: #ffffff;
}


.Num-input {
    text-align: center;
    width: 50px;
    border: 1px #3571c3 solid;
    border-radius: 5px;
}
